This is a large kitchen, so I designed a refrigerator on the cook's side of the island and another on the bar side of the island so those eating could access drinks/ice, etc without disturbing the cook. It also allows more than one cook to work comfortably. The large breakfast area is open and sunny with lots of windows and doors. Photo credit Pamela Foster

To make better use of space for a large family, and entertaining, we took out a peninsula and added a huge island. The dark stain on the island and banquette help pull together the light maple on the existing perimeter cabinets and the knotty pine paneling in this original Craftsman home.

Two sisters inherited this home in Torrance, CA. and wanted to start the home’s remodel with a new kitchen. They are passionate cooks who enjoy taking the occasional class to sharpen their skills. They were looking for a chef’s kitchen focused on efficiency. Professional grade appliances were required for them to achieve this effect. The glass backsplash is a mosaic tile in black and white. The flooring is marble with an inlay border. The new homeowners wanted a butler’s pantry and built in Thermador espresso machine for their new space. The peninsula offers seating for guests as they cook. The project includes a 54 inch stainless steel vent hood complete with backsplash and shelving.

In addition to wanting a warm and welcoming updated kitchen, our clients had a unique request, they wanted a built in wall microwave separate from the wall convection oven and wall thermal oven and we modified the cabinet area to accommodate the stack. We also modified a space for the warming drawer. Photo credit to Sergio Garza.
